Chelsea Anne Manalo is making headlines for being the first woman to win title Miss Universe Philippines. Manalo was born in Meycauayan, Bulacan, Philippines with an Filipino mother and an African American father, her multiracial background has played a major influence on her opinions and advocacy initiatives. Her childhood was characterized by difficulties, including being bullied because of her skin color and hairstyle which later inspired her dedication to promoting inclusiveness and body positivity.

What did Manalo accomplished in her pageant career?

Manalo’s path through this world of beauty pageantry started by participating in Miss World Philippines 2017, in which she was competing against 34 other contestants in the SM Mall of Asia Arena in Pasay City, Metro Manila. Her performance was impressive and was enough to earn her a place in the Top 15. This first success set her way to her amazing victory for the position of Miss Universe Philippines 2024. Informally crowned on February 17th 2024, Manalo is now scheduled to be the representative of Philippines in Miss Universe 2024. Miss Universe 2024 competition in Mexico in September.

What is the way Manalo stand up for his people? Dumagat people?

Beyond the glamour and glitz of show-stopping pageants, Manalo is deeply involved in advocacy efforts, particularly focused on the well-being of the Dumagat people, a native community from Norzagaray, Bulacan. Her mission is to draw attention to the issues faced by this minority group as well as promoting their rights, and assisting in initiatives that aid in their well-being and the preservation of their culture.
